Our client, a premier law firm, is looking for an experienced litigation attorney to join their team in Boston, MA. This role offers the chance to handle sophisticated disputes, advise businesses operating in highly regulated markets, and contribute to a growing practice focused on complex and evolving legal issues. The position is well suited for someone who thrives in a dynamic environment, values strategic collaboration, and brings strong courtroom and case management experience.
Job Responsibility
Manage a broad range of civil litigation matters, including contract disputes, consumer protection claims, product liability actions, and intellectual property litigation
Conduct comprehensive legal research and prepare pleadings, motions, briefs, memoranda, and other litigation-related filings
Represent clients in court appearances, hearings, mediations, arbitrations, and other dispute resolution proceedings
Work closely with attorneys and support staff to develop litigation strategies and secure successful outcomes for clients
Advise clients on litigation exposure, risk management considerations, and strategic opportunities throughout the course of representation
Support the firm’s business development efforts through client engagement, networking, marketing initiatives, and relationship building
Requirements
4 or more years of litigation experience, preferably representing businesses and corporate clients in state and federal courts, arbitration proceedings, and administrative appeals
Experience in commercial litigation, defense-side product liability matters, or admission to the California Bar is preferred
Juris Doctor (J.D.) degree from an accredited law school
Active membership in the Massachusetts Bar and good standing in all applicable jurisdictions
Strong legal research, analytical, and persuasive writing abilities
Excellent oral advocacy, negotiation, and courtroom presentation skills
Demonstrated ability to manage matters independently while collaborating effectively within a team-oriented environment
High level of professionalism, sound judgment, integrity, and commitment to exceptional client service
Ability to manage competing priorities and perform effectively in a fast-paced, deadline-driven practice
